Meanings
-
1
adv
Used to say that something is possible but not certain; maybe.
Perhaps John will come over for dinner tonight.
-
2
adv
Used to make a suggestion or request sound more polite.
Perhaps you could help me carry these bags?

Etymology
From Middle English perhappes, perhappous, variant of earlier perhap (“perhaps, possibly”), equivalent to per + hap (“chance, coincidence”) + -s, on model of Middle English parchaunce (modern perchance).
